centos7 Kafka部署(单机版)一、概念:Kafka主要应用场景是:日志收集系统和消息系统。 Kafka是最初由Linkedin公司开发,是一个分布式、分区的、多副本的、多订阅者,基于zookeeper协调的分布式日志系统(也可以当做MQ系统)。 采用zookeeper对集群中的broker和comsumer进行管理;可以注册topic到zookeeper上,通过zookeeper的协调机
转载
2024-04-21 20:28:58
513阅读
kafka一、概述1.1 消息队列(MQ)使用消息队列的好处消息队列的两种模式1.2 Kafka 简介1.3 Kafka 的特性1.4 Kafka 系统架构BrokerTopic=PartitionLeaderFollowerReplicaProducerConsumerConsumer Group(CG)offset 偏移量Zookeeper二、部署kafka服务2.1 准备工作2.2 安装k
转载
2024-03-15 13:49:39
68阅读
如今小程序需求越来越大,尤其是其中的商城小程序需求量特别大,越来越多的商户为了将流量最大化,都开始选择采购商城小程序。就拿有赞和微盟来说,一套商城小程序系统,基本都在万元上下,有些需求复杂,价格会更高。正常市场上,单单一套传统的商城系统的售价也在4000-9000元左右。从以上例子可以看出,小程序的销售利润空间是非常大的,特别是对于代理别人产品的网络公司,不用承担高额的开发成本,运营成本。但是,这
# 在Kubernetes部署Kafka Exporter
## 介绍
在本文中,我将向你介绍如何在Kubernetes中部署Kafka Exporter。Kafka Exporter是一个用于监控Apache Kafka集群的工具,它提供了关于Kafka集群中各个指标的详细信息,如消息速率、分区偏移量等。通过部署Kafka Exporter,你可以更好地了解Kafka集群的运行状况,并及时采取
原创
2023-08-14 08:03:22
1070阅读
什么是kafkaApache Kafka® 是 一个分布式流处理平台上面是官网的介绍,和一般的消息处理系统相比,不同之处在于:kafka是一个分布式系统,易于向外扩展它同时为发布和订阅提供高吞吐量它支持多订阅者,当失败时能自动平衡消费者消息的持久化和其他的消息系统之间的对比:对比指标kafkaactivemqrabbitmqrocketmq背景Kafka 是LinkedIn 开发的一个高性能、
转载
2024-10-03 12:27:34
33阅读
文章目录kafka快速入门1.安装部署1.1 集群规划1.2 jar包下载1.3 集群部署1.4 启动/停止集群myzookeeper.shmykafka.sh2. Kafka命令行操作☆ kafka快速入门1.安装部署1.1 集群规划hadoophadoop101hadoop102zkzkzkkafkakafkakafka1.2 jar包下载http://kafka.apache.org/do
0、前言Kafka的度量指标主要有以下三类:1.Kafka服务器(Kafka)指标2.生产者指标3.消费者指标另外,由于Kafka的状态靠Zookeeper来维护,对于Zookeeper性能的监控也成为了整个Kafka监控计划中一个必不可少的组成部分。一、Broker度量指标Kafka的服务端度量指标是为了监控broker,也是整个消息系统的核心。因为所有消息都通过kafka broker传递,然
转载
2024-03-01 19:14:02
363阅读
一,介绍kafka-exporter: 个人开发的专门提供数据给Prometheus ,其他的metric 需要JMX Exporter
github: https://github.com/danielqsj/kafka_exporter二,安装部署这里是k8s daemonset模式部署,二进制部署方式网上很多blackbox-exporter-daemonset.yamlapiVersion
Apache Kafka Streams 是一个用于构建流处理应用的客户端库,它允许用户直接在Kafka之上编写应用程序,处理和转换输入数据流,并输出到其他Kafka Topic或其他目的地。在源码解析的角度来看,Kafka Streams 主要涵盖以下几个关键部分:Stream Processing Topology:在Kafka Streams中,所有的流处理逻辑都被表示为一个拓扑结构(Top
kafka概述消息中间件对比特性ActiveMQRabbitMQRocketMQKafka开发语言javaerlangjavascala单机吞吐量万级万级10万级100万级时效性msusmsms级以内可用性高(主从)高(主从)非常高(分布式)非常高(分布式)功能特性成熟的产品、较全的文档、各种协议支持好并发能力强、性能好、延迟低MQ功能比较完善,扩展性佳只支持主要的MQ功能,主要应用于大数据领域消
转载
2024-04-28 22:43:25
39阅读
kafka传递保证语义Delivery guarantee semanticAt most once :消息可能会丢失,但绝不会重复传递。At least once :消息绝不会丢失,但可能会重复传递。Exactly once :每条消息只会被传递一次。At least once + consumer 幂等。如何实现Exactly once:实现Exactly once 需要生产者与消费者两部分共
转载
2024-10-17 06:29:09
134阅读
一 BufferPool 上一篇已经整理了ProducerBatch,本文继续看BufferPool。ByteBuffer的创建和释放时比较消耗资源的,池化的目的是降低创建和销毁时间,提升执行效率,即将原来的创建和销毁时间降为从池中获取和归还入池的时间。为了实现内存的高效利用,Kafka客户端使用BufferPool来实现ByteBuffer的复用。在package org.
转载
2024-09-09 14:00:23
82阅读
部署 MySQL Exporter
====================
介绍
----
MySQL Exporter是用于监控MySQL数据库的开源软件。它从MySQL实例中收集性能指标并将其暴露给Prometheus进行监控和报警。在本文中,我们将学习如何部署MySQL Exporter并将其与Prometheus集成,以便我们可以监控MySQL数据库的运行状况。
安装MySQL Ex
原创
2023-12-30 11:04:11
205阅读
## Redis Exporter 部署
Redis Exporter 是一个开源的监控工具,用于将 Redis 的指标导出到 Prometheus。本文将介绍如何部署 Redis Exporter,并提供相应的代码示例。
### 什么是 Redis Exporter?
Redis Exporter 是一个用于导出 Redis 指标的工具。它可以收集 Redis 的各种性能指标,如内存使用、
原创
2023-12-18 08:30:21
51阅读
!Exporter.png(https://s2.51cto.com/images/20211210/1639091183705382.png?xossprocess=image/watermark,size_14,text_QDUxQ1RP5Y2a5a6i,color_FFFFFF,t_100,g_se,x_10,y_10,shadow_20,type_ZmFuZ3poZW5naGVpdGk=)
原创
精选
2021-12-10 07:07:48
6021阅读
点赞
三、kafka HA
3.1 replication如图.1所示,同一个 partition 可能会有多个 replica(对应 server.properties 配置中的 default.replication.factor=N)。没有 replica 的情况下,一旦 broker 宕机,其上所有 patition 的数据都不可被消费,同时 producer 也不能再将数据存于其
转载
2024-08-27 18:10:07
80阅读
总的来说,Kafka Producer是将数据发送到kafka集群的客户端。其组成部分如下图所示:基本组件:Producer Metadata——管理生产者所需的元数据:集群中的主题和分区、充当分区领导者的代理节点等。Partitioner——计算给定记录的分区。Serializers——记录键和值序列化器。 序列化程序将对象转换为字节数组。Producer Interceptors——可能改变记
转载
2024-04-08 07:52:46
74阅读
Kafka2.8.x安装与配置Kafka安装Kafka单机版安装Kafka常用操作命令Kafka集群安装及配置Kafka名词说明Kafka主题管理及分区主题管理分区管理副本机制分区Leader选举分区重新分配分区分配策略 Kafka安装参考官网:http://kafka.apache.org/documentation/#quickstart 前置条件要有JDK8+的环境,这里不赘述。Kafka
转载
2024-03-22 09:21:21
104阅读
一、Kafka核心总控制器 定义:kafka集群中的一个负责管理所有分区和副本的状态的broker。PS:kafka单台机器也叫集群。 职能:选举新的leader副本、ISR变更通知所有broker更新其元数据、让新分区被其他节点感知。当某个分区的leader副本出现故障时,由控制器负责为该分区选举新的leader副本。 当检测到某个分区的ISR集合发生变化时,由控制器负责通知所有broker
转载
2024-03-29 11:03:00
140阅读
引言目前kafka使用越来越频繁,集群压力也越来越大,做好对
原创
2022-11-18 15:56:10
1084阅读